Brief Summary | The purpose of this prospective, Phase 2, multicenter, blinded, randomized placebo controlled study is to demonstrate that early treatment with mavrilimumab prevents progression of respiratory failure in patients with severe COVID-19 pneumonia and clinical and biological features of hyper-inflammation. | ||||||
Detailed Description | This prospective, Phase 2, multi-center, blinded randomized placebo-controlled study is designed to demonstrate that early treatment with mavrilimumab prevents progression of respiratory failure in patients with severe Covid-19 pneumonia and clinical and biological features of hyper-inflammation. The study population includes patients who have severe pneumonia, defined as hospitalization due to Covid-19 with abnormal chest imaging and SpO2 <92% on room air or requirement for supplemental oxygen. Enrollment: The study will be performed in approximately 4 months total, starting from the first patient enrolled with enrollment expected to complete within 2 months. Follow-up period: The follow-up period is 60 days for each patient enrolled. A total of 60 patients will be randomized using a 1:1 allocation ratio: 30 subjects will receive mavrilimumab, and 30 subjects will receive placebo infusion. The investigator, clinical team, and subject will be blinded to treatment assignment. Participants will be identified by regular review of hospitalized COVID19 patients to evaluate for inclusion and exclusion criteria. Participants will then be approached in the standard manner by study investigator and coordinator/research nurse. Research interventions will take place in the hospital in accordance with privacy standards. The study team is informed on all study procedures and requirements with daily meetings and the opportunity to continuously update through secure channels. In this multicenter consortium, each participating site will have their own IND for patients enrolled at their site. Data collection, data analysis, and randomization scheme will be performed by one site, Cleveland Clinic C5 Research. |
